Troubleshooting

Troubleshooting
This section may help you isolate the cause of a problem
and as a result, eliminate the need to contact technical
support.
The unit cannot be operated  A function that
does not work is assigned to the ASSIGN 1/2 button.
Check the settings in the [Assign Button Setting]
screen.
The black bars appear at the upper and lower or left
and right positions of the display  When the
signal aspect ratio is different from that of the panel,
the black bars appear. This is not a failure of the unit.
Adjustments and settings cannot be made 
Adjustments and settings may not be possible
depending on the input signals and the status of the
unit. See "Input Signals and Adjustable/Setting Items"
(page 16).
The screen becomes dark and the unit turns off
 If the internal temperature of the unit increases,
the screen may become dark and the unit may turn off.
Check if the ventilation slots or vents are blocked with
something such as dust.
In this case, refer to Sony qualified service personnel.
Color is not displayed correctly  Check the
[Interface Format] display or the [Signal Format],
[Color Temp.], or [Color Space] setting.
An afterimage is displayed  An afterimage may be
displayed depending on the input image. This is not a
malfunction.
